Cushings’s syndrome due to ectopic adrenocorticotrophin (ACTH) secretion was first described nearly a century ago by Hurst Brown. Bronchial carcinomas, usually bronchial carcinoids, were the first to be described and continue to be the leading cause of the ectopic ACTH syndrome; however, thymic carcinoids account for approximately 10% of cases. The pathogenesis of flushing attacks in patients with malignant carcinoid tumors is attributed to the direct pharmacologic effect of excessive amounts of circulating serotonin. It was hoped that potent serotonin antagonists might relieve symptoms of the carcinoid syndrome in the inoperable patient.
